Don't Rain On My Parade! (Table of Contents: 4)

Cheryl Blossom / comic story / 21 pages (report information)

Script
Dan Parent (credited); Frank Doyle (credited)
Pencils
Stan Goldberg (credited)
Inks
Rudy Lapick (credited)
Colors
Barry Grossman (credited)
Letters
Bill Yoshida (credited)

Genre
humor; teen
Characters
Cheryl Blossom; Jason Blossom; Betty Cooper; Veronica Lodge; Archie Andrews; Reggie Mantle; Jughead Jones; Fred Andrews; Birdie Birdwell; The Governor; Miss Brown
Synopsis
Cheryl and her brother Jason plan to upstage the Archies at a local parade, and think back to the last time they tried a similar plan.
Reprints

Indexer Notes

This appears to be two stories combined into one. Pages 5 thru 15 are titled "The Governor's Gig" and may come from a stand-alone story of that name with the rest of this story a new sequence added before and after.

Design For Danger (Table of Contents: 10)

Archie / comic story / 11 pages (report information)

Script
Frank Doyle
Pencils
Stan Goldberg
Inks
Jon D'Agostino
Colors
?
Letters
Bill Yoshida

Genre
adventure; teen
Characters
Archie Andrews; Reggie Mantle; Veronica Lodge; Betty Cooper; "Dandy" Carlo (a fashion designer); Mario (a thug); Jughead Jones
Synopsis
Archie tries to interview Dandy Carlo, a fashion designer the girls love. But Dandy is being forced to sell his designs against his will. Archie then disguises himself as Dandy to lead the villains away.
Reprints
Keywords
fashion design; kidnapping

Indexer Notes

The character "Dandy" Carlo is named after Archie artist Dan DeCarlo. This story is told in two parts: part 1 (6 pages) and part 2 (5 pages).
